cub starting
Here is the pitch. Got cub that started but needed lots of choke. Also the Governor was not working right. so--- took governor off and took it apart cleaned it up and put in new oil seal and spring. Put it back on the tractor. Tractor will not start at all got several explosions on top of muffler. Thats all. Is there any way I could have screwed up anything when I reinstalled the governor or shou;ld I ;look further. Henry

Re: cub starting
What ignition system does your Cub have? Magneto, battery powered. or magneto with external coil.
Since tractor "ran", sort of, prior to removing the governor, the ignition timing is off. The correction will depend on the answer to the previous question.
Any way, one tooth off on the governor-ignition drive gear installation equals a 10 degree change in point the ignition system fires.
Edit: Tackle one problem at a time. Cub apparently has a carburetion problem. Tackle the ignition problem first.
Question: What is the history on this tractor?
